Here are some helpful ways to build your child\u2019s vocabulary through everyday activities at home.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>Be a careful listener.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> It may take time for your child to express himself. Listen carefully and allow your child to take the needed time to communicate.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>When speaking to your child, use real words.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> It may be fun to use \u201cplay words,\u201d but as your child learns and grows, take the opportunity to use real words for your child to repeat and understand. While some \u201cplay words\u201d are cute, they can be confusing and stifle vocabulary.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>Ask plenty of probing questions. <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Your questions will create opportunities for your child to think, reason, and express himself better.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>Encourage your child regularly.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> Always look for opportunities to affirm and encourage your child. Respond with care and thoughtfulness as your child learns to express thoughts and feelings.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>Keep your baby talking and making sounds.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> Your baby is growing and developing in many ways. Engaging activities, talking, and fun interactions are ways your child learns and develops. Even though your baby may not understand your words, he will recognize your voice and body language.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><b>Read to your child regularly. <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Choose a fun book appropriate for your child\u2019s age and read regularly. Your child will begin to recognize and repeat words. Also, discuss what the words mean.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">This blog was provided by <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/kidsrkids.com\/blog\/build-your-childs-vocabulary\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Kids \u2018R\u2019 Kids International<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>A few months after a beautiful baby is born, parents begin to hear exciting sounds of joy and personal expression.
